SOGO論壇
  登入   註冊   找回密碼
查看: 4059|回覆: 2
列印 上一主題 下一主題

[程式設計] [VB6.0]設定IE首頁 [複製連結]

Rank: 13Rank: 13Rank: 13Rank: 13

原創及親傳圖影片高手勳章 熱心參予論壇活動及用心回覆主題勳章

狀態︰ 離線
跳轉到指定樓層
1
發表於 2009-3-28 10:59:28 |只看該作者 |倒序瀏覽

首先,請在"一般─宣告"內插入以下程式碼:



Private Declare Function RegCreateKey Lib "advapi32.dll" Alias "RegCreateKeyA" _
(ByVal hKey As Long, ByVal lpSubKey As String, phkResult As Long) As Long

Private Declare Function RegSetValueEx Lib "advapi32.dll" Alias "RegSetValueExA" _
(ByVal hKey As Long, ByVal lpValueName As String, ByVal Reserved As Long, _
ByVal dwType As Long, lpData As Any, ByVal cbData As Long) As Long

Private Declare Function RegCloseKey Lib _
"advapi32.dll" (ByVal hKey As Long) As Long

Private Const REG_SZ = 1
Private Const HKEY_CURRENT_USER = &H80000001
Private Const ERROR_SUCCESS = 0

Public Sub SetStartPage(Home As String)
Dim hKey As Long
If RegCreateKey(HKEY_CURRENT_USER, "SoftwareMicrosoftInternet ExplorerMain", hKey) = ERROR_SUCCESS Then
RegSetValueEx hKey, "Start Page", 0, REG_SZ, ByVal Home, Len(Home)
RegCloseKey hKey
End If
End Sub



然後,在表單上建立一Commmand Button 2個控制項(陣列型態)
(建立一個按鈕,然後複製→貼上→建立控制項陣列)

並在按鈕中插入以下程式碼:




Select Case Index
Case 0
SetStartPage "http://www.google.com.tw/"
Case 1
SetStartPage "http://tw.yahoo.com"
End Select




執行後,只要點選按鈕1,就會進入Google網站~
請依個人需求自行修改程式碼。
喜歡嗎?分享這篇文章給親朋好友︰
               感謝作者     

Rank: 5Rank: 5

狀態︰ 離線
2
發表於 2009-3-28 15:19:10 |只看該作者
請問哪裡可以找到VB6.0的載點阿

論壇顧問

Q^心靈導師^Q

Rank: 14Rank: 14Rank: 14Rank: 14

顧問勳章 原創及親傳圖影片高手勳章 布布達人勳章

狀態︰ 離線
3
發表於 2009-3-28 23:26:54 |只看該作者
原帖由 a2588388 於 2009-3-28 15:19 發表
請問哪裡可以找到VB6.0的載點阿


官網有提供免費版的下載,功能不差,註冊完畢就可以拿到金鑰,過程也很簡單,以下是微軟載點...
點我前往微軟官網載點
請注意︰利用多帳號發表自問自答的業配文置入性行銷廣告者,將直接禁訪或刪除帳號及全部文章!
您需要登錄後才可以回覆 登入 | 註冊


本論壇為非營利自由討論平台,所有個人言論不代表本站立場。文章內容如有涉及侵權,請通知管理人員,將立即刪除相關文章資料。侵權申訴或移除要求:abuse@oursogo.com

GMT+8, 2024-11-23 01:03

© 2004-2024 SOGO論壇 OURSOGO.COM
回頂部